
Mystery at Number Six
'Mystery at Number Six' Summary
Peg and Clare are spending their vacations in Florida, doing ordinary things. They are not expecting anything unusual. But then along came a mysterious girl named Betty Drew who tried to hire them as spies. She wants them to follow a businessman who lives in the house at number six because she thinks that he is a counterfeiter and she wants to prove it. The teens agreed and soon they are wrapped up in a dangerous mystery with crooks, secret messages, codes, and hidden treasure.Book Details
